According to the GICv2 specification section 4.3.7, "Interrupt Set-Pending Registers, GICD_ISPENDRn":
"In a multiprocessor implementation, GICD_ISPENDR0 is banked for each connected processor. This register holds the Set-pending bits for interrupts 0-31."
